2. What Cookies Are
Cookies are small text files stored on a browser or device when a website is visited. Similar technologies, including local storage and session identifiers, may store or access information for comparable purposes. In this Policy, “cookies” includes these similar technologies where appropriate.
Session cookies expire when the browser session ends. Persistent cookies remain for a defined period or until deleted. First-party cookies are set for the Website domain; third-party cookies may be set by a service used for an essential function such as payment or security.
